    Funder: Idaho Community Foundation

    Due Dates: June 15, 2026 (Northern & Eastern Regions) | August 15, 2026 (Southwestern & South Central Regions)

    Funding Amounts: Maximum request: $25,000; most grants range $3,000–$8,000; one-year duration.

    Summary: Flexible funding for nonprofits and public entities to address community needs across Idaho, awarded through four regional cycles.


    Description

    The Forever Idaho Regional Grant Program, administered by the Idaho Community Foundation, provides general operating support and flexible funding to address evolving needs within Idaho communities. The program is structured around four regional grant cycles, ensuring that funding is distributed equitably and responsively across the state. Grants may be used for a wide range of direct or indirect organizational costs, including payroll, rent, utilities, supplies, equipment, project expenses, capital improvements, and programmatic needs. The program is designed to support impactful work in areas such as arts and culture, community benefit, education, environment, health, and housing stability.
